From 37b094e88617d264dfa70a6a4af522fba2b865a8 Mon Sep 17 00:00:00 2001 From: vng Date: Wed, 6 Apr 2011 23:42:00 +0300 Subject: [PATCH] Fix timer in logging. --- base/logging.cpp |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/base/logging.cpp b/base/logging.cpp index d13e0d491e..348be40633 100644 --- a/base/logging.cpp +++ b/base/logging.cpp @@ -36,10 +36,14 @@ namespace my std::cerr << names[level]; else std::cerr << level; - int64_t const milliseconds = static_cast(s_Timer.ElapsedSeconds() * 1000 + 0.5); - std::cerr << " " << std::setw(3) << milliseconds / 1000 << "." << std::setw(4) << std::setiosflags(std::ios::left) << (milliseconds % 1000) << std::resetiosflags(std::ios::left); - std::cerr << " " << srcPoint.FileName() << ":" << srcPoint.Line() << " " << srcPoint.Function() - << "() " << msg << endl; + + //int64_t const milliseconds = static_cast(s_Timer.ElapsedSeconds() * 1000 + 0.5); + //std::cerr << " " << std::setw(6) << milliseconds / 1000 << "." << std::setw(4) << std::setiosflags(std::ios::left) << (milliseconds % 1000) << std::resetiosflags(std::ios::left); + + double const sec = s_Timer.ElapsedSeconds(); + std::cerr << " " << std::setfill(' ') << std::setw(10) << sec; + + std::cerr << " " << srcPoint.FileName() << ":" << srcPoint.Line() << " " << srcPoint.Function() << "() " << msg << endl; LogCheckIfErrorLevel(level); }